b. City of Stonecrest State of Emergency
(ends on May 11, 2020)
Mayor Lary and Plez Joyner, Deputy City Manager, addressed the council and
reassured them that the City Hall ordered face masks, gloves, thermometers, and
sanitizer. At this point there is not an official date for City Hall to reopen.
EXECUTIVE SESSION
None.
XIII. CITY MANAGER UPDATE
Deputy City Manager Plez Joyner- Thanked everyone for another great virtual
meeting. Stated that Stonecrest Cares delivered 5000 masks to Hillandale Hospital
along with Council Member Rob Turner, Council Member Jimmy Clanton and Mayor
Lary. Planning on delivering more to first responders and some retail establishments.
Thanked Iris Settle and Lillian Lowe for organizing Stonecrest Cares.
